One of the most intriguing ad hoc monologues I've ever heard at a con
(science ficiton convention) was Gordy Dickson talking about the lack of a
feminine equivalent of the word "hero". ("Heroine" certainly isn't it!)
His example of such a character was Pilar in _For Whom the Bell Tolls_.
